Handover: Vexlor stale-cache postmortem (Arda → Plen). Root cause: TTL reset skipped on partial writes, serving stale pricing for ~40 min. Fix merged; invalidation now atomic. Postmortem doc drafted, needs your sign-off before Thursday release notes. Monitoring alert added on cache-age p99. One loose end: the incident vault holding raw logs re-seals weekly, and reopening it takes the recovery passphrase, noted here for you.

vault phrase of tajef-tafog = istox-sorax-zorox-casok-holox-kelix-weneth-drueth-casion

**Mgmt Meeting Minutes — Retiring the Brightline Range**

Quick recap for sales leads at Fenholt Supplies: we agreed to retire the Brightline fixture range by year-end. Remaining stock moves to clearance pricing next month, and accounts on standing orders get migrated to the Lumetta range. Trade-in incentives were approved in principle. The confidential note on next steps sits just below.

board note of bajof-bajeg: The pricing group signed off on a budget of $13.4 million for Project Sildor. The renewal with Lamixek Holdings closes at $48.9 million a year, 49 percent above the last contract.

Ticket: GATE-1182 — Rate limiter rejecting bursts below threshold. The Lanternworks internal gateway is returning 429s on the profile-sync route even when clients stay under the configured 200 req/min ceiling. Suspect the sliding-window counter double-counts retried requests. As a new contractor, start by reproducing with the staging harness, then compare counter values against the audit log. Do not change limits in production. The trace token from the failing request is recorded below.

session token of tajef-bageg = htk21_5d90d574934f3ccae6437

# Sharding configuration for the Pellwick user-profile store.
# New team members: profiles are hash-sharded by account key across
# the Ormsgate replica sets, and rebalancing is gradual by design —
# moving too many shards at once caused the cache stampede of last
# spring. Read the migration runbook before touching anything here,
# and coordinate changes with the storage rotation. The shard-count
# and rebalance constants are defined below.

limits module of fajog-tawig:
RATE_LIMITS = {
    "druwyn": 2,
    "quenael": 10,
    "wenix": 2,
    "druael": 2,
}